摘要
Aiming at the complex problem of logistics distribution, in order to achieve the shortest path and the least total cost, this paper analyzes and designs the logistics distribution network from the two aspects of distribution center location and path optimization. Firstly, the improved clustering algorithm is used to determine the distribution center, the corresponding supply point and distribution point of each distribution center, then the ant colony algorithm is used to optimize the path, and finally the distribution center and the corresponding distribution path are determined. In the end of this paper, the case analysis is carried out to find out the best distribution center and the shortest path, which gets an optimized distribution network, so as to achieve the purpose of the lowest cost.
